The Texas Instruments MSP432P411YTPZR is a microcontroller unit (MCU) that belongs to the MSP432P4 family of ultra-low power 32-bit ARM Cortex-M4F-based MCUs. This MCU is designed to provide high performance and low power consumption for a wide range of applications.
The MSP432P411YTPZR is a high-performance MCU that features an ARM Cortex-M4F processor with a floating-point unit (FPU) and a maximum CPU frequency of up to 48 MHz. The MCU is equipped with 256 KB of flash memory, 32 KB of SRAM, and a wide range of communication interfaces, including I2C, SPI, UART, and USB. The device also includes a variety of peripheral modules, such as timers, comparators, and a 12-bit ADC.
